Escape From the Tea Party! Luffy vs. Big Mom

EpisodeEp. 841

A Whole Cake Island arc episode where Caesar ferries Bege away while the Vinsmokes hold off the Big Mom Pirates, Luffy briefly trades blows with Big Mom, and Judge throws himself at her only to be crushed.

Funimation Air Date: June 16, 2018
Character Debut: Charlotte Cornstarch

Summary

Once Bege returns to his ordinary body and Caesar and Germa 66 spill out, the pair are left exposed and the Big Mom Pirates open fire. Ichiji, Niji, Yonji, and Reiju throw themselves in front of the bullets, and Caesar grabs Bege and lifts off with Germa in tow. Katakuri predicts they mean to clear the wall and flee the venue. Judge swings at Katakuri and misses as the enemy crew leaps to attack.

Big Mom halts her own subordinates and hurls Prometheus into the group. Reiju absorbs the worst of the blast and crashes to the ground. Luffy strains to break away and aid her, but his crew holds him fast. When Mascarpone and Joscarpone try to finish Reiju off, she kicks and poisons them, prompting Smoothie to come purge the toxin. As Big Mom readies Zeus against Reiju, both Luffy and Sanji vault out of Bege to block it, each irritated the other tagged along.

Key Events

Sanji hauls Luffy away and the two flee with Reiju, but Big Mom's taunts about his promise to beat her lure Luffy back for one defiant strike. He activates Gear 4 and lands Kong Gun, declaring he will be Pirate King, only for her to repel it with Armament Haki coating her arms. In the air the Germa siblings keep the bullets off Caesar: Niji scatters attackers with Dengeki Blue, Yonji hurls foes into one another, and Ichiji drives Dacquoise down with Sparking Red. Oven, Daifuku's genie, and Smoothie each try to halt Caesar's flight and are intercepted in turn, and the three brothers shatter Perospero's candy wall to keep Caesar's escape route open.

Notes

On a ledge below, Lu Feld scrambles toward the fallen Tamatebako, but Stussy reveals herself as an undercover CP0 agent, downs him with Tobu Shigan, and claims the box for the World Government, striking a deal with the spying Morgans. Feld's slumping body then knocks the Tamatebako off the Chateau entirely. Above, Luffy vows to take down Kaidou before Big Mom, who swats him out of Gear 4. Judge flies in to attack, ashamed of being deceived in his bid to revive Germa's glory, but she snaps his spear in her teeth and blasts him with a Zeus thunderbolt. The episode introduces Charlotte Cornstarch and belongs to the Whole Cake Island arc; the anime has Luffy strike Big Mom twice rather than once.
